I just added a whole-tone lower to my 5th string, which means the poor string is gonna have twice as much work to do. I'm wondering what gauge you players who have this change use? Thanks.

Most folks use a 017 -- some use 018
Those gauges lower a whole tone or more with no problem on most guitars. A lot of folks have the B to A on the 'Franklin pedal' with G# to F# on 6 and B to A on 10. I don't know of anyone having to change string gauge to get that change.

Are you having problems getting it to lower all the way?
